Freddy King Foundation donates learning materials to schools in Effia Constituency
The Freddy King Foundation has donated learning materials to seven (7) schools in the Effia Constituency of the Western Region on Friday, June 17.
The Chief Executive Officer (CEO) of the foundation, Mr Fredrick Dodou, as part of his birthday celebration decided to show love to some deprived schools, including his alma mater in the municipality he grew up in.
The schools were his former Junior High School, Rev Cobbah Yalley JHS, Archbishop Porter A Primary School, T.I Ahmadiyah Primary School, Effia Methodist Primary School, Dunwell Methodist Primary School, Al-Zahra Primary School and Tanokrom M/A Primary School.
Some of the items given to the students were water bottles, over two thousand customised exercise books, story books, pens and mathematical sets.
The headteachers of the schools also provided the foundation with names of needy but brilliant students who are going to be supported throughout their education including their families as well.
He said, “The headteachers will furnish us with the names of needy but brilliant students, we know these schools don’t pay fees but there are some levies they pay and for money to even take care of them from their homes; we will like to support the family with that.”
Mr Freddy also proposed a vacation class at the end of every term in all seven (7) schools which the foundation will facilitate to see to it that, students do not engage themselves in illicit acts during such periods.
He said, “We will pay the teachers for the vacation classes, the children will not have not to pay anything, the only thing they have to do is to come to the vacation class to avoid the issues of kids getting into trouble”
Mr Doudu speaking to Skyy News indicated the objective of this exercise was not only to share items with the students but to also get access to the school, know the challenges the schools are facing and know how best they can do to resolve them.
